I had a cbc and everything was normal except my doc said my platelets were a little low i'm worried about leukemia i've had a blood spot on my lip for months. doc says its usually a lab problem.

A doctor has provided 1 answer

No worry: Slightly low platelet counts are actually quite normal. Sometimes the platelets clump together a little bit prior to the automated machine counting them, so a clump of 10 platelets may count as 1-2. Leukemia is a disease that affects your white blood cells, and these are normal on your cbc, so there is no reason to worry about that. Enjoy the spring and please do not dwell on isolated lab number.
